You’ve probably heard the term “quantum computer,” but what does it actually mean? How is it different from the computer you’re using right now? In this article, we’ll break down the core principles of quantum computing in clear and simple language—no physics degree required.
Why Quantum Computers Matter
Quantum computers have the potential to solve problems that would take traditional computers years—or even centuries—to complete. They’re being researched for applications like breaking encryption, accelerating drug discovery, and optimizing logistics at scales never before possible.
This isn’t just science fiction. Tech giants like IBM, Google, and Microsoft are heavily investing in quantum technology. As development progresses, quantum computing is poised to reshape industries and redefine what technology can do.
Classical vs. Quantum Computers: What’s the Difference?
Traditional computers process information using bits, which represent either 0 or 1. Every app, file, and website you use is ultimately composed of billions of bits working in sequences.
Quantum computers, on the other hand, use qubits. Qubits can exist in a state of 0, 1, or both at the same time, thanks to a quantum property called superposition. They can also be entangled, meaning the state of one qubit is instantly connected to the state of another, regardless of distance.
Feature | Classical Computer | Quantum Computer |
---|---|---|
Basic Unit | Bit (0 or 1) | Qubit (0 and 1 simultaneously) |
Computation | Sequential | Parallel (via superposition and entanglement) |
Strength | Reliability, general use | Speed and handling of complex problems |
Understanding Qubits, Superposition, and Entanglement
What is a Qubit?
A qubit is the quantum version of a bit. It can be an electron, photon, or ion that’s carefully controlled to hold quantum information. Unlike a regular bit, which is either on or off, a qubit holds a range of probabilities until it’s measured.
Superposition
This is the ability of a qubit to be in a combined state of 0 and 1. It allows quantum computers to explore many solutions simultaneously, offering exponential speedups in certain computations.
Entanglement
Entangled qubits share a special link: changing one instantly affects the other. This unique behavior enables powerful, coordinated calculations that would be impossible with classical systems.
How Quantum Computers Operate
Quantum computation involves four major steps:
- Initialization: Qubits are set to a known starting state.
- Quantum Gate Operations: Quantum gates manipulate qubits by rotating or entangling them.
- Entangled State Processing: Multiple qubits perform parallel calculations through shared states.
- Measurement: The final quantum state is collapsed into classical values (0s or 1s) to extract a result.
Example: Grover’s Algorithm
Let’s say you’re searching for one item among a hundred. A classical computer might need 50 tries. Grover’s quantum algorithm can find it in about 10. This kind of speed-up is possible only because quantum computers test multiple paths at once.
Current Limitations and Challenges
Despite their promise, quantum computers face several hurdles:
- Error Rates: Qubits are fragile and easily disturbed by noise.
- Decoherence: Quantum states degrade quickly, limiting computation time.
- Scalability: Building systems with thousands of stable qubits remains a major challenge.
Still, research is progressing fast. Limited quantum computers already exist, and hybrid approaches are being explored for near-term applications.
Real-World Applications and Future Potential
Sector | Potential Impact |
---|---|
Cybersecurity | Cracking RSA encryption and developing post-quantum cryptography |
Pharmaceuticals | Simulating molecules to design new drugs faster |
Logistics | Optimizing complex supply chains and routing problems |
Finance | High-speed risk modeling and fraud detection |
AI | Accelerated machine learning through quantum-enhanced algorithms |
In the future, quantum computing may enable innovations like real-time climate modeling, advanced materials discovery, and breakthroughs in clean energy.
Conclusion: Why You Should Understand Quantum Computing Now
Quantum computing is still in its infancy, but its long-term impact will be transformative. Whether you work in tech or not, understanding the basics of this technology could be crucial for staying ahead in a future shaped by exponential change.
By learning how quantum computers work today, you’re preparing for a world where they could power everything from scientific research to AI to the security systems that keep our data safe.